Todd Hofflander - Hells Canyon Wilderness - Idaho

Todd Hofflander - Hells Canyon Wilderness - Idaho

Author: Locations Unknown March 20, 2021 Duration: 58:55
September 24th 2010, 39 year old Todd Hofflander joined some friends on a multi day hunting trip in the remote Idaho wilderness area called Hells Canyon.  As an experienced hiker, Todd was well equipped to spend multiple days in the backcountry and had been on trips like this before.  On the 4th day of the trip, Todd experienced knee pain and decided to split from the group.  This would be the last time anyone would see Todd until his remains were discovered a decade later.  Join us this week as we discuss the disappearance of Todd Hofflander.

Locations Unknown ventures into the silent, vast spaces where people have simply gone missing. Hosts Mike & Joe guide each episode through a specific case, piecing together timelines from the final known moments, through the often-frustrating official searches, and into the lingering questions that haunt families and park rangers alike. This isn't just a true crime podcast; it’s a close look at the intersection of human error, unpredictable nature, and the peculiar geography of places like dense national forests and isolated mountain ranges that can swallow a person whole. You’ll hear about the decisions made in the critical hours, the terrain that complicated everything, and the community of experts and amateurs who keep looking. The show naturally explores how these landscapes, while beautiful, hold secrets, making the wilderness itself a central character in every story. Tune in for a respectful, detailed examination of stories that end not with a conclusion, but with an open map and a deepened mystery. The podcast digs into the cultural fascination with these vanishings and what they reveal about our relationship with the wild, remote corners of the country.
